Transaction 288687896cffd853d83a33b4e76ccaa343ef7c4ce551525e17c1e5b752f3bf02
1 Input
1 Output
-
288687896cffd853d83a33b4e76ccaa343ef7c4ce551525e17c1e5b752f3bf02:0
- value
- 125424
- script pubkey
- OP_0 OP_PUSHBYTES_32 eebd56cc019f654422c160cfbc9fd3632a1a68cf105f5f6d671ee9100fab878b
- address
- bc1qa674dnqpnaj5ggkpvr8me87nvv4p56x0zp047mt8rm53qrats79ssf3k60